A warmer climate leads to rising sea levels. Despite uncertainties about how rapid and substantial future sea-level rise (SLR) will be, society needs to prepare and adapt. This study examines the state of planning for future SLR in Sweden by surveying 33 coastal municipalities in southern Sweden and interviewing local, regional and national authorities with relevant accountability. The results reveal that there are considerable gaps in current planning for SLR. Almost one-third of municipalities lack guiding planning documents for SLR, and more than two-thirds do not discuss SLR beyond 2100. We argue that the prevailing uncertainty and ambiguity in assessments of future SLR is problematic within a traditional “predict-then-act” paradigm, and that robust approaches, such as scenario planning, can reduce many of these problems.  相似文献

Phytoplankton can bypass nutrient reductions in eutrophic coastal water bodies     
Maximilian Berthold  Ulf Karsten  Mario von Weber  Alexander Bachor  Rhena Schumann 《Ambio》2018,47(1):146-158
The EU-water framework directive aims at nutrient reductions, since anthropogenically induced eutrophication is a major threat for coastal waters. However, phytoplankton biomass in southern Baltic Sea coastal water bodies (CWB) remains high and the underlying mechanisms are not well understood. Therefore, a CWB data set was analysed regarding changes in phytoplankton biomass and nutrient concentration of nitrogen (N) and phosphorus (P) from 2000 to 2014. It was expected to find imbalances between produced phytoplankton biomass and total nutrient concentrations. Inner CWB were cyanobacteria-dominated and showed up to five times higher chlorophyll a-concentrations compared to outer CWB with similar total phosphorus-concentrations. Phytoplankton tended to be P-limited during spring and N-limited during summer. Phytoplankton biomass and nutrient concentrations were even higher during very humid years, which indicated a close coupling of the CWB with their catchment areas. This study suggests that re-mesotrophication efforts need to consider the importance of changed phytoplankton composition and nutrient availabilities.  相似文献

A review of ecosystem service benefits from wild bees across social contexts     
Denise Margaret S. Matias  Julia Leventon  Anna-Lena Rau  Christian Borgemeister  Henrik von Wehrden 《Ambio》2017,46(4):456-467
In order to understand the role of wild bees in both social and ecological systems, we conducted a quantitative and qualitative review of publications dealing with wild bees and the benefits they provide in social contexts. We classified publications according to several attributes such as services and benefits derived from wild bees, types of bee–human interactions, recipients of direct benefits, social contexts where wild bees are found, and sources of changes to the bee–human system. We found that most of the services and benefits from wild bees are related to food, medicine, and pollination. We also found that wild bees directly provide benefits to communities to a greater extent than individuals. In the social contexts where they are found, wild bees occupy a central role. Several drivers of change affect bee–human systems, ranging from environmental to political drivers. These are the areas where we recommend making interventions for conserving the bee-human system.  相似文献

From Obstructionism to Communication: Local,National and Transnational Dimensions of Contestations on the Swedish Wolf Cull Controversy     
Erica von Essen  Michael P. Allen 《Environmental Communication: A Journal of Nature and Culture》2017,11(5):654-666
Two obstructionist ways of doing politics on contentious wildlife management issues currently reflect a legitimacy deficit in official channels for public engagement. The first is that of a pernicious “direct-action” politics, in the form of resort by hunters in rural Sweden to illegal killings of protected wolves over whose policy they contest. The second obstruction is when environmental non-governmental organizations routinely file appeals in higher-level courtrooms contesting democratically mandated wolf cull decisions. Although markedly different when it comes to their categorically deliberative values as well as fidelity to the law, we argue both extra-legal and the litigative phenomena reflect disenfranchisement with the participation channels in which such controversies may be resolved through a public dialogue. We also argue that both possess negative systemic deliberative value inasmuch as they frustrate goals of reaching deliberative consensus, by contributing to a stalled public communication on wolf management. We address this deficit by appeal to recent developments in the theory and practice of mini-publics that promote both the categorical and systemic deliberative value of channeling contestation. In particular, we appeal to a novel conception of hunter-initiated, but citizen controlled, mini-publics as a vehicle for re-starting stalled public communication on wolf conservation.  相似文献

Atmospheric composition change – global and regional air quality     
P.S. Monks  C. Granier  S. Fuzzi  A. Stohl  M.L. Williams  H. Akimoto  M. Amann  A. Baklanov  U. Baltensperger  I. Bey  N. Blake  R.S. Blake  K. Carslaw  O.R. Cooper  F. Dentener  D. Fowler  E. Fragkou  G.J. Frost  S. Generoso  P. Ginoux  R. von Glasow 《Atmospheric environment (Oxford, England : 1994)》2009,43(33):5268-5350
Air quality transcends all scales with in the atmosphere from the local to the global with handovers and feedbacks at each scale interaction. Air quality has manifold effects on health, ecosystems, heritage and climate. In this review the state of scientific understanding in relation to global and regional air quality is outlined. The review discusses air quality, in terms of emissions, processing and transport of trace gases and aerosols. New insights into the characterization of both natural and anthropogenic emissions are reviewed looking at both natural (e.g. dust and lightning) as well as plant emissions. Trends in anthropogenic emissions both by region and globally are discussed as well as biomass burning emissions. In terms of chemical processing the major air quality elements of ozone, non-methane hydrocarbons, nitrogen oxides and aerosols are covered. A number of topics are presented as a way of integrating the process view into the atmospheric context; these include the atmospheric oxidation efficiency, halogen and HOx chemistry, nighttime chemistry, tropical chemistry, heat waves, megacities, biomass burning and the regional hot spot of the Mediterranean. New findings with respect to the transport of pollutants across the scales are discussed, in particular the move to quantify the impact of long-range transport on regional air quality. Gaps and research questions that remain intractable are identified. The review concludes with a focus of research and policy questions for the coming decade. In particular, the policy challenges for concerted air quality and climate change policy (co-benefit) are discussed.  相似文献

Seasonal and spatial trends in the sources of fine particle organic carbon in Israel,Jordan, and Palestine     
Erika von Schneidemesser  Jiabin Zhou  Elizabeth A. Stone  James J. Schauer  Radwan Qasrawi  Ziad Abdeen  Jacob Shpund  Arye Vanger  Geula Sharf  Tamar Moise  Shmuel Brenner  Khaled Nassar  Rami Saleh  Qusai M. Al-Mahasneh  Jeremy A. Sarnat 《Atmospheric environment (Oxford, England : 1994)》2010,44(30):3669-3678
A study of carbonaceous particulate matter (PM) was conducted in the Middle East at sites in Israel, Jordan, and Palestine. The sources and seasonal variation of organic carbon, as well as the contribution to fine aerosol (PM2.5) mass, were determined. Of the 11 sites studied, Nablus had the highest contribution of organic carbon (OC), 29%, and elemental carbon (EC), 19%, to total PM2.5 mass. The lowest concentrations of PM2.5 mass, OC, and EC were measured at southern desert sites, located in Aqaba, Eilat, and Rachma. The OC contribution to PM2.5 mass at these sites ranged between 9.4% and 16%, with mean annual PM2.5 mass concentrations ranging from 21 to 25 ug m?3. These sites were also observed to have the highest OC to EC ratios (4.1–5.0), indicative of smaller contributions from primary combustion sources and/or a higher contribution of secondary organic aerosol. Biomass burning and vehicular emissions were found to be important sources of carbonaceous PM in this region at the non-southern desert sites, which together accounted for 30%–55% of the fine particle organic carbon at these sites. The fraction of measured OC unapportioned to primary sources (1.4 μgC m?3 to 4.9 μgC m?3; 30%–74%), which has been shown to be largely from secondary organic aerosol, is relatively constant at the sites examined in this study. This suggests that secondary organic aerosol is important in the Middle East during all seasons of the year.  相似文献
